Форум программистов
 
Контакты: о проблемах с регистрацией, почтой и по другим вопросам пишите сюда - alarforum@yandex.ru, проверяйте папку спам! Обязательно пройдите активизацию e-mail.

Вернуться   Форум программистов > Microsoft Office и VBA >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ail


Донат для форума - использовать для поднятия настроения себе и модераторам

А ещё здесь можно купить рекламу за 25 тыс руб в месяц! ) пишите сюда - alarforum@yandex.ru

Ответ
 
Опции темы
Старый 25.01.2011, 16:30   #1
pahmyt
 
Регистрация: 25.01.2011
Сообщений: 5
Репутация: 10
По умолчанию Удаление нескольких символов из ячейки СПРАВА!

Добрый день! В ячейке имеются данные типа

"Палец поршневой J934046- 43 шт,"

Необходимо удалить из ячейки справа все до названия, чтобы осталось только "Палец Поршневой". Артикул может быть разной длины, может начинаться с буквы или цифры. Как минимум, есть ли возможность удалить удалить СПРАВА определенное количество символов, например 15?

Заранее благодарен, прошу прощения, если эта тема где-то была.
pahmyt вне форума   Ответить с цитированием
Старый 25.01.2011, 16:41   #2
Serge 007
Профессионал
 
Аватар для Serge 007
 
Регистрация: 15.12.2009
Адрес: excelworld
Сообщений: 1,340
Репутация: 191
По умолчанию

Здравствуйте.
Цитата:
Сообщение от pahmyt Посмотреть сообщение
...есть ли возможность удалить удалить СПРАВА определенное количество символов, например 15?
Код:
=ЛЕВСИМВ(A1;ДЛСТР(A1)-15)
или
Код:
=ПОДСТАВИТЬ(A1;ПРАВСИМВ(A1;15);"")
или
Код:
=ЗАМЕНИТЬ(A1;НАЙТИ(ПРАВСИМВ(A1;15);A1);15;"")
Для ответа на первый вопрос необходим пример Ваших данных.
__________________
Бесплатная помощь: www.excelworld.ru
Платная помощь: serge_007.planetaexcel@mail.ru
https://money.yandex.ru: 41001419691823

Последний раз редактировалось Serge 007; 25.01.2011 в 16:45.
Serge 007 вне форума   Ответить с цитированием
Старый 25.01.2011, 16:47   #3
pahmyt
 
Регистрация: 25.01.2011
Сообщений: 5
Репутация: 10
По умолчанию

Спасибо за оперативный вопрос!!

Пример данных приложен.

Разные длины названий, количество, длина артикула....
Вложения
Тип файла: rar sample.rar (3.6 Кб, 89 просмотров)
pahmyt вне форума   Ответить с цитированием
Старый 25.01.2011, 17:01   #4
Hugo121
Профессионал
 
Регистрация: 11.05.2010
Сообщений: 5,033
Репутация: 464
По умолчанию

UDF+формулы
Вложения
Тип файла: rar sample.rar (8.3 Кб, 157 просмотров)
__________________
webmoney: E265281470651 Z422237915069 R418926282008
Hugo121 вне форума   Ответить с цитированием
Старый 25.01.2011, 17:13   #5
kuklp
Профессионал
 
Регистрация: 02.05.2010
Адрес: Украина, Днепропетровск.
Сообщений: 1,390
Репутация: 152

icq: 4190413
skype: pilipnik
По умолчанию

Пробуйте, на месте макросом.
Вложения
Тип файла: rar sample1.rar (9.6 Кб, 136 просмотров)
kuklp вне форума   Ответить с цитированием
Старый 25.01.2011, 17:14   #6
pahmyt
 
Регистрация: 25.01.2011
Сообщений: 5
Репутация: 10
По умолчанию

Да уж, Ексель - это кладезь возможностей!

Спасибо огромное!

Если есть можно - подобная ситуация (вложена).
Здесь отличия - артикул может быть один, может быть несколько (записаны через ">>", "<<"). Возможно, ориентироваться на удаление скоплений цифр (больше 4х)?

В названиях (которые не нужно удалять) максимум 4х значные числа могут встречаться.
Вложения
Тип файла: rar sample2.rar (8.4 Кб, 35 просмотров)
pahmyt вне форума   Ответить с цитированием
Старый 25.01.2011, 17:28   #7
kuklp
Профессионал
 
Регистрация: 02.05.2010
Адрес: Украина, Днепропетровск.
Сообщений: 1,390
Репутация: 152

icq: 4190413
skype: pilipnik
По умолчанию

Цитата:
Сообщение от pahmyt Посмотреть сообщение
Возможно, ориентироваться на удаление скоплений цифр (больше 4х)?
Ну да. А в конце может быть "шт." Не, такой бардак разгребать...
kuklp вне форума   Ответить с цитированием
Старый 25.01.2011, 17:41   #8
pahmyt
 
Регистрация: 25.01.2011
Сообщений: 5
Репутация: 10
По умолчанию

Ну ничего, спасибо и на этом!!!
pahmyt вне форума   Ответить с цитированием
Старый 25.01.2011, 17:45   #9
kuklp
Профессионал
 
Регистрация: 02.05.2010
Адрес: Украина, Днепропетровск.
Сообщений: 1,390
Репутация: 152

icq: 4190413
skype: pilipnik
По умолчанию

Ну, попробуйте так.
Вложения
Тип файла: rar sample3.rar (11.7 Кб, 118 просмотров)
kuklp вне форума   Ответить с цитированием
Старый 25.01.2011, 17:58   #10
Hugo121
Профессионал
 
Регистрация: 11.05.2010
Сообщений: 5,033
Репутация: 464
По умолчанию

Сергей, я всё UDFками. Подход 4-х работает, главное чтоб не было шт. Но это можно пофиксить SUBSTITUTE()
Вложения
Тип файла: rar sample2.rar (10.0 Кб, 92 просмотров)
__________________
webmoney: E265281470651 Z422237915069 R418926282008
Hugo121 вне форума   Ответить с цитированием
Ответ

Опции темы

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ход

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Удаление нескольких строк с условием Ppaa Microsoft Office Excel 4 20.12.2010 17:42
Удаление из нескольких таблиц qwerty1301 Microsoft Office Access 17 05.05.2010 11:34
Удаление нескольких записей Hobbit_88 БД в Delphi 5 23.04.2009 17:18
Удаление символов из ячейки gavrylyuk Microsoft Office Excel 2 26.08.2008 16:44
Удаление символов MURAD Общие вопросы C/C++ 3 19.08.2007 01:25


10:17.


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2019, Jelsoft Enterprises Ltd.